The Competitive Landscape of Asia-Pacific Industrial Automation Market


In the intricate orchestra of modern manufacturing across Asia-Pacific, industrial automation systems hum like silent conductors, orchestrating precision, efficiency, and productivity. This market pulsates with diverse solutions and challenges, demanding a deeper look at the strategies driving it, factors shaping market share, and emerging trends reshaping its industrial melody.


Key Players:



  • ABB Ltd.

  • Hitachi, Ltd.

  • Mitsubishi Electric Corporation

  • OMRON Corporation

  • Rockwell Automation, Inc.

  • Siemens

  • Yokogawa Electric Corporation

  • Koyo Electronic Industries Co., Ltd.

  • Industrial Automation (M) Sdn Bhd

  • Emerson Electric Co.


Strategies Adopted by Leaders:



  • Technological Prowess: Siemens and ABB lead the charge with expertise in comprehensive industrial automation solutions encompassing robotics, process control systems, and integrated software platforms, catering to large-scale manufacturing facilities.

  • Vertical Specialization: Rockwell Automation focuses on cost-effective automation solutions for smaller factories and specific industries like food and beverage, while Mitsubishi Electric targets niche applications like automation for semiconductors and automotive manufacturing.

  • Partnership Play: Schneider Electric collaborates with system integrators and industry experts, offering customized solutions and seamless integration of complex automation systems.

  • Open-Source Initiatives and Interoperability: The Open Platform Communications Unified Architecture (OPC UA) promotes standardized communication protocols and data formats, benefiting the entire industry through compatibility and flexibility.

  • Focus on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ning: Implementing AI-powered algorithms for predictive maintenance, process optimization, and data-driven decision making enhances efficiency, productivity, and overall performance.


Factors for Market Share Analysis:



  • Solution Comprehensiveness and Scalability: Companies offering automation solutions with various components – robots, PLCs (Programmable Logic Controllers), HMI (Human-Machine Interface) systems, and integrated software – command premium prices and secure market share by catering to diverse manufacturing needs and production scales.

  • Cost Competitiveness and Affordability: Balancing advanced functionalities with an attractive price point is crucial for capturing market share, particularly in price-sensitive segments like smaller factories and emerging markets.

  • Cybersecurity and System Reliability: Prioritizing robust cyber defense measures and ensuring system reliability minimizes production downtime, protects critical infrastructure, and builds trust with manufacturers.

  • Integration with Smart Factories and IoT (Internet of Things): Offering automation solutions compatible with smart factory initiatives and seamlessly integrating with IoT sensors and devices opens doors to new market opportunities and real-time data-driven optimization.

  • Focus on Sustainability and Energy Efficiency: Providing automation solutions that optimize energy consumption, minimize waste, and support sustainable manufacturing practices attracts environmentally conscious businesses and promotes responsible production.


New and Emerging Companies:



  • Startups like Geek+ and Yujin Robot: These innovators focus on developing next-generation robotics platforms and mobile robots for automated material handling, warehouse logistics, and collaborative tasks, aiming to revolutionize factory floor operations and enhance worker safety.

  • Academia and Research Labs: The National University of Singapore's Department of Mechanical Engineering and Tokyo University of Science's Advanced Robotics Research Center explore disruptive technologies like self-learning robots, advanced 3D printing for automation components, and bio-inspired manufacturing processes, shaping the future of the market.

  • Advanced Software and Cloud-Based Solutions: Companies like PTC and SAP develop AI-powered manufacturing execution systems (MES) and cloud-based automation platforms, enabling real-time production monitoring, predictive maintenance, and data-driven insights for optimized factory performance.


Industry Developments:


ABB Ltd.:



  • October 26, 2023: Unveiled their ABB Ability™ Power Grid Automation portfolio with advanced software solutions for managing and optimizing energy distribution networks, aiming to address grid modernization challenges in the region.

  • July 2023: Partnered with a leading Chinese automotive manufacturer to implement robotic automation solutions in their factories to improve production efficiency and quality.


Hitachi, Ltd.:



  • October 25, 2023: Showcased their Lumada Manufacturing Suite, a digital transformation platform leveraging AI and data analytics for optimizing industrial processes and predicting maintenance needs.

  • June 2023: Collaborated with a Japanese electronics company to develop innovative cobots for precision assembly tasks in their production lines.


Mitsubishi Electric Corporation:



  • October 20, 2023: Launched their e-F@ctory cloud-based manufacturing platform offering comprehensive solutions for factory automation, remote monitoring, and data-driven decision making.

  • March 2023: Acquired Precise Automation & Robotics, a Singaporean company specializing in robotics system integration, strengthening their market presence in Southeast Asia.
